There was a lot of beautiful scenery to take in, but mostly from a bus. I certainly would not opt for this trip over Mt Titlis or Jungfrau, but since I had time to do all I enjoyed it. I was glad to stop by Vaduz, Liechtenstein, just to say I'd been there; however, there isn't really anything to see. So this trip isn't a must, but it was okay.

It's called the Heidiland tour, but we only arrived 5 minutes before the Heidiland museum closed, and by the time we rushed through the museum the souvenir shop was closed. It should not be called a Heidiland tour when you get such short a time there, and it was what I had particularly gone on the tour to see. Also, it did not spend long enough in Liechtenstein either, as it took ages to get served in the shops there. The tour guide was great, a real character and very informative, and the countryside was very scenic, so we had a great day apart from Heidiland.
